Wei Fan is a scholar working on Polymers and Plastics, Biomedical Engineering and Biomaterials. According to data from OpenAlex, Wei Fan has authored 118 papers receiving a total of 3.1k indexed citations (citations by other indexed papers that have themselves been cited), including 47 papers in Polymers and Plastics, 31 papers in Biomedical Engineering and 28 papers in Biomaterials. Recurrent topics in Wei Fan’s work include Advanced Sensor and Energy Harvesting Materials (25 papers), Natural Fiber Reinforced Composites (23 papers) and Mechanical Behavior of Composites (22 papers). Wei Fan is often cited by papers focused on Advanced Sensor and Energy Harvesting Materials (25 papers), Natural Fiber Reinforced Composites (23 papers) and Mechanical Behavior of Composites (22 papers). Wei Fan collaborates with scholars based in China, Malaysia and United States. Wei Fan's co-authors include Shujuan Wang, Shengbo Ge, Kai Dong, Su Shiung Lam, Lili Xue, Linjia Yuan, Tao Liu, Wei‐Chun Chen, Changlei Xia and Bing-Jye Wang and has published in prestigious journals such as Advanced Materials, Nature Communications and ACS Nano.
